Botox for migraines side effects

Posted by johnetteg @johnetteg, Nov 25, 2018

I had Botox injections for migraines 2 1/2 weeks ago and have been feeling sick. My vision is blurry, I have pressure in my head, I’m lightheaded, I’m having heart palpitations, high blood pressure and heart rate, my stomach has felt sick, I’m having trouble concentrating and focusing. Has anyone else experienced this? It’s really starting to scare me.

I have usedBotox for a number of years now with very good success, most of the time. Occasionally, my body seems to not respond to one of the rounds of treatment. Initially, I did not get results from the shots but I was told by some people who had success that it took a little while for it to work, so I continued to get the treatments and by the third round of Botox, my migraines dropped in half. They have now dropped by 2/3 generally. Good luck with your decision! I don’t like the shots, but I do like the results.
